The term “light therapy” refers to various types of exposure to lamps that generate infrared, visible, and ultraviolet radiation. But many people don't realize that this therapy can also be effective for major depression and depression that occurs during or after pregnancy, known as perinatal depression. By enhancing serotonin levels, light therapy aims to alleviate symptoms of depression and anxiety, promoting a more positive and stable. To use light therapy, you need to. Light therapy, also known as phototherapy, is a treatment involving exposure to an artificial light source. Light therapy — which involves sitting close to a special light source every morning for at least 30 minutes — can help improve sad. Also known as phototherapy or bright light therapy, light therapy can be used to treat sad and other conditions by using artificial light.
